Companion Care from Companion Services of America – Deerfield, IL

Companion care is non-medical home care focused on social engagement, safety supervision, and everyday support — conversation, hobbies, meal companionship, and light reminders — for older adults who are largely independent but shouldn't be alone.

How Companion Services of America – Deerfield, IL Delivers Companion Care

Companion Services of America provides in-home companion care combining emotional support with practical assistance including meal preparation, housekeeping, errands, and engagement in activities to combat loneliness. Care is tailored to individual needs and available as 24-hour, live-in, or hourly visits.

How It Works Here

  • Caregivers prepare nutritious meals tailored to dietary needs and preferences
  • Assist with housekeeping tasks including dusting and mopping, and laundry
  • Provide errands assistance including grocery shopping
  • Engage in conversations, games, and activities to combat loneliness
  • Services available across home, hospital, and assisted living facility settings
  • Offer 24-hour care, live-in support, or hourly visits tailored to individual needs
  • Provide both short-term and long-term care options

Frequently Asked Questions

What role does nutrition play in companion care at Companion Services of America?

Caregivers assist with meal preparation, grocery shopping, and planning healthy meals to support overall health and well-being, ensuring seniors receive balanced meals that meet their dietary needs.

How can companion care help seniors stay engaged in hobbies?

Caregivers provide assistance and companionship during activities such as setting up art supplies, playing games, or accompanying seniors to community events to foster a sense of purpose and enjoyment.

How does companion care support seniors during holidays and special events?

Caregivers help with home decorating, meal preparation, and accompany seniors to family gatherings to make these occasions more enjoyable and stress-free.
